Bitcoin hashrate hits all-time high, Enhancing Network Security

The Bitcoin network has achieved a new record for its hashrate, underscoring the increasing strength and security of the world’s pioneering blockchain system. On October 21, the total computing power securing the Bitcoin blockchain — known as the network hashrate — surged to an unprecedented 769.8 exahashes per second (EH/s). SEC Greenlights Bitcoin Options ETFs on NYSE and CBOE

On October 18, the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) gave the green light for the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) and Chicago Board Options Exchange (CBOE) to list long-awaited options for spot Bitcoin exchange-traded funds (ETFs). UAE Central Bank Approves Stablecoin Issuer

The Central Bank of the United Arab Emirates (CBUAE) has given in-principle approval to AED Stablecoin under its Payment Token Service Regulation framework, as announced in the company’s press release. FBI Arrests Hacker Behind Fake SEC Bitcoin ETF Approval Announcement

A 25-year-old man from Athens, Alabama, has been arrested by the FBI for hacking into the Securities and Exchange Commission’s (SEC) official X account earlier this year in January. Italy Set to Increase Bitcoin Capital Gains Tax from 26% to 42%

Italy is planning to raise its capital gains tax on Bitcoin (BTC) from 26% to 42%. This increase could prompt some crypto investors to leave the country or seek alternative strategies to mitigate the impact.
